Section 1: Understanding Publix Sales Cycles
Sales cycles at Publix are structured in a way that allows shoppers like me to anticipate discounts and plan accordingly. Each week, I can expect to see a variety of items on sale, ranging from fresh produce to household essentials. Typically, these sales begin on Wednesdays and run through the following Tuesday, providing a full week to take advantage of discounts.
Weekly Sales
Each week, Publix features a new set of sales, which are highlighted in their weekly ads. These ads can be found both in-store and online, allowing me to review what’s on sale before heading out to shop. The items featured in these ads often include a mix of grocery staples and seasonal products, ensuring there’s something for everyone.
The sales cycle is consistent, so I know that every Wednesday, I can expect a fresh batch of deals. This regularity not only helps in planning my shopping trips but also allows me to budget better, as I can stock up on items I know will be on sale.

Section 2: When Do Publix Sales Start?
Understanding when Publix sales start is essential for maximizing my savings. The typical start days for sales can vary, but there are some general trends that I have noticed.
Typical Start Days
As mentioned earlier, Publix weekly sales generally begin on Wednesdays. This means that every Wednesday, I can look forward to new sales and discounts available through the following Tuesday. By planning my shopping trips for Wednesday or Thursday, I can ensure that I’m getting the freshest selection of sale items.
Moreover, I’ve discovered that some stores may have slight variations in their sales start days, particularly in different regions. Therefore, it’s a good idea to check with my local Publix to confirm the exact start dates.

Using Coupons
Another excellent way to save at Publix is by utilizing coupons. I often combine coupons with sales for even greater discounts. Publix accepts manufacturer coupons, and I can find many digital coupons through the Publix app or website.
When I stack these coupons with weekly sales, I can sometimes get items for a fraction of their original price. I make it a habit to check for digital coupons before heading out to shop, as this can lead to substantial savings.
